Rationale:Essential Agreement • August 1st, 2019
Contract Type FiledAugust 1st, 2019Home Learning helps students by complementing and reinforcing classroom learning, fostering good lifelong learning and study habits, encouraging organisational skills and providing an opportunity for students to be responsible for their own learning. It also promotes the home school partnership.
